interleave

in·ter·leave [ ìntər lv ] (past and past participle in·ter·leaved, present participle in·ter·leav·ing, 3rd person present singular in·ter·leaves)


transitive verb 
Definition:
 
add extra pages to a book: to add extra sheets or pages, usually blank ones, between the pages of a book, e.g. to allow for notes or to protect illustrations

[Mid-17th century. <inter- + leaf]
